Here’s how you ensure your stackable home works as a true residence: <dl> <dt style="font-weight:bold;"> Modular Prefab Construction </dt> <dd> A factory-built structure assembled in controlled conditions using standardized components, ensuring precision and consistency in materials and finishes. </dd> <dt style="font-weight:bold;"> Stackable Design </dt> <dd> A vertical arrangement where one module is placed atop another, maximizing square footage without increasing ground footprint ideal for small lots or zoning-restricted areas. </dd> <dt style="font-weight:bold;"> Integrated Utilities </dt> <dd> Prewired electrical panels, preplumbed drainage lines, and HVAC ducting routed through structural frames so no retrofitting is required after installation. </dd> </dl> To confirm functionality, follow these steps: <ol> <li> Verify local building codes Some jurisdictions classify stackable homes as “accessory dwelling units” (ADUs, requiring permits for occupancy. Check if your area allows permanent residency in such structures. </li> <li> Confirm utility hookups Ensure the model includes standard NEMA outlets, ¾-inch water inlet/outlet connections, and a 4-inch sewer vent pipe compatible with your existing system. </li> <li> Test insulation ratings Look for R-20 wall insulation and double-pane windows. In colder climates, radiant floor heating in the lower level adds comfort. </li> <li> Validate appliance certifications The kitchen should include UL-listed appliances; the bathroom must have GFCI-protected outlets and an exhaust fan rated for moisture removal (minimum 50 CFM. </li> <li> Assess accessibility Stairs between levels should be at least 36 inches wide with handrails. Doorways need to be 32 inches minimum for ADA compliance if intended for long-term use. </li> </ol> Sarah’s experience confirms that daily life in this unit is practical: she cooks meals in the kitchen, showers after yoga sessions, and uses the upper-level office space for video calls. Here’s what makes them viable for daily use: <dl> <dt style="font-weight:bold;"> Induction Cooktop </dt> <dd> Uses electromagnetic energy to heat cookware directly, offering faster boiling times, precise temperature control, and zero open flame safer in confined spaces. </dd> <dt style="font-weight:bold;"> Low-Flow Plumbing Fixtures </dt> <dd> Designed to meet EPA WaterSense standards, reducing water consumption while maintaining adequate pressure for showers and sinks. </dd> <dt style="font-weight:bold;"> Moisture-Resistant Finishes </dt> <dd> Bathroom walls use PVC-backed drywall or cement board; countertops are solid surface or quartz composite both resist mold and warping. </dd> <dt style="font-weight:bold;"> Integrated Ventilation </dt> <dd> Exhaust fans are hardwired to timers or humidity sensors, automatically removing steam and odors without user intervention. </dd> </dl> To evaluate whether these fixtures will hold up in your environment, follow this checklist: <ol> <li> Check appliance certifications Verify UL listing for the fridge and cooktop. Avoid units labeled “decorative only.” </li> <li> Measure clearance around appliances The fridge needs 2 inches of breathing room behind it; the stove requires 18 inches of unobstructed front space. </li> <li> Inspect drain slope The bathroom floor should slope toward the drain at ¼ inch per foot. Test this before final installation by pouring water. </li> <li> Confirm electrical load capacity A 15-amp circuit is insufficient for induction + fridge + lights simultaneously. Demand a dedicated 20-amp circuit for the kitchen zone. </li> <li> Review warranty terms Reputable manufacturers offer 5-year warranties on plumbing and electrical components. The key lies in its material composition: <dl> <dt style="font-weight:bold;"> Aluminum Frame Structure </dt> <dd> Lightweight yet rigid, resistant to rust and termites. Anodized finish prevents oxidation even in salty air environments. </dd> <dt style="font-weight:bold;"> Composite Wall Panels </dt> <dd> Made from fiber-reinforced polymer (FRP) with UV-stabilized outer layer resists fading, cracking, and delamination under direct sunlight. </dd> <dt style="font-weight:bold;"> Sealed Roof System </dt> <dd> Flat roof with EPDM rubber membrane (synthetic rubber) welded at seams, rated for 20+ years of service life and capable of holding snow loads up to 30 psf. </dd> <dt style="font-weight:bold;"> Double-Glazed Windows </dt> <dd> Argon-filled, Low-E coated glass with thermal breaks in frames to prevent condensation and heat loss in sub-zero temperatures. </dd> </dl> To verify structural readiness for your climate, proceed with these steps: <ol> <li> Request wind load rating Units should be rated for at least 90 mph sustained winds (Category 1 hurricane equivalent. Coastal regions require higher ratings. </li> <li> Ask for snow load certification If you live in areas receiving >20 inches of annual snowfall, demand proof of 30+ psf (pounds per square foot) capacity. </li> <li> Inspect seam sealing All joints between panels, windows, and doors should be filled with silicone-based sealant approved for exterior use (ASTM C920 compliant. </li> <li> Check foundation compatibility While some models sit on concrete piers, others require a poured slab. Confirm which is recommended for your soil type (clay, sand, loam. </li> <li> Review manufacturer testing reports Reputable brands provide third-party lab results for thermal performance, air infiltration rates, and impact resistance. </li> </ol> Mark’s unit passed every test. One major trend among early adopters: delays occur not due to manufacturing defects, but because delivery crews underestimate site access requirements. Many customers assume the unit arrives ready to drop but in reality, crane access, ground leveling, and utility routing often cause bottlenecks. For example, a homeowner in Vermont ordered a comparable unit expecting a flatbed truck to deliver it directly to their backyard. They discovered their narrow driveway couldn’t accommodate the 12-foot-wide trailer. The solution? Hire a local excavator to widen the path ($800 extra) and schedule delivery during dry weather to avoid mud. Another recurring issue involves misaligned door hinges or uneven stair treads not from poor craftsmanship, but from transit vibration. Most units arrive partially assembled. Final tightening of bolts and adjustment of thresholds must be done on-site by the installer. Here’s what users commonly report after 6–12 months of ownership: <style> /* */ .table-container width: 100%; overflow-x: auto; -webkit-overflow-scrolling: touch; /* iOS */ margin: 16px 0; .spec-table border-collapse: collapse; width: 100%; min-width: 400px; /* */ margin: 0; .spec-table th, .spec-table td border: 1px solid #ccc; padding: 12px 10px; text-align: left; /* */ -webkit-text-size-adjust: 100%; text-size-adjust: 100%; .spec-table th background-color: #f9f9f9; font-weight: bold; white-space: nowrap; /* */ /* & */ @media (max-width: 768px) .spec-table th, .spec-table td font-size: 15px; line-height: 1.4; padding: 14px 12px; </style> <!-- 包裹表格的滚动容器 --> <div class="table-container"> <table class="spec-table"> <thead> <tr> <th> Issue Type </th> <th> Frequency Reported </th> <th> Typical Resolution </th> </tr> </thead> <tbody> <tr> <td> Door alignment drift </td> <td> Medium (30% of cases) </td> <td> Adjust hinge screws; apply lubricant to latch mechanism </td> </tr> <tr> <td> Slight window fogging </td> <td> Low (12% of cases) </td> <td> Replace desiccant pack in dual-pane unit; check seal integrity </td> </tr> <tr> <td> Electrical outlet polarity mismatch </td> <td> Very Low (5% of cases) </td> <td> Use multimeter to test wiring; rewire if needed by licensed electrician </td> </tr> <tr> <td> Plumbing leak at connection point </td> <td> Low (8% of cases) </td> <td> Tighten compression fittings; replace O-rings if corroded </td> </tr> <tr> <td> Paint chipping at corner edges </td> <td> Low (10% of cases) </td> <td> Touch-up with matching enamel paint; apply clear sealant annually </td> </tr> </tbody> </table> </div> Maintenance is straightforward: biannual inspection of seals, quarterly cleaning of gutters (if installed, and annual lubrication of moving parts (hinges, drawer slides.
